简介:本文深入浅出地探讨了迁移学习与泛化的概念,解析了它们在机器学习领域中的重要作用,并通过实例展示了这些技术如何在实际应用中提升模型性能与适应性。
在快速发展的机器学习领域,迁移学习与泛化作为两大核心技术,正逐步成为推动模型性能提升与广泛应用的重要力量。迁移学习通过复用已有知识解决新问题,而泛化则强调模型对新数据的适应能力。本文将简明扼要地介绍这两者的基本概念、原理及实际应用,旨在为非专业读者提供易于理解的技术指南。
定义与原理
迁移学习(Transfer Learning)是一种机器学习方法,其核心思想是将在一个或多个源任务上学到的知识迁移到目标任务上,以提高目标任务的学习效率和性能。这种方法利用了不同任务之间的相似性,避免了从零开始训练模型的耗时与资源消耗。
实际应用
定义与重要性
泛化(Generalization)是指模型对未见过的数据做出准确预测的能力。在机器学习中,一个具有良好泛化能力的模型能够在新情境下保持稳定的性能,是评估模型优劣的重要指标之一。
提升泛化能力的方法
迁移学习与泛化在机器学习中相互依存、相互促进。迁移学习通过复用已有知识,帮助模型在新任务上快速收敛,提高学习效率;而泛化能力则是评估迁移学习效果的重要指标之一。一个成功的迁移学习模型,往往能够在新任务上展现出良好的泛化性能。
迁移学习与泛化作为机器学习的两大核心技术,为模型性能的提升与广泛应用提供了有力支持。通过深入理解这两者的原理与应用,我们可以更好地利用已有资源,快速解决新问题,推动机器学习技术的持续发展。未来,随着技术的不断进步与应用的不断拓展,迁移学习与泛化将在更多领域发挥重要作用,为人类社会带来更多便利与福祉。